While Nightcrawlers might have a syndicate on the angling scene, do not mark down the power of other worm selections. These little wigglers are your secret tools if you're looking for a surefire method to catch smaller fish.
These black-and-yellow worms are little yet mighty, loading a strike when it concerns drawing in fish, particularly smaller sized ones. Their soft appearance and pleasant aroma make them tempting to Panfish, Trout, and Crappie, along with Chub, Carp, and also Catfish. Although not technically a worm (it's really moth larvae), these little pests have a track record for being a delicious treat on the block due to their high-fat content (according to the fish, anyhow) and have actually additionally shown to be decent fishing worms throughout the cooler periods.

Worms learn the facts here now are delicate to warmth and light, and they can die quickly if subjected to them. Avoid congestion the container, as this can cause anxiety to the worms and lead to their fatality. Manage your worms with care, even when baiting your hook. Stay clear of utilizing hooks that are also big or sharp, as they can hurt them and you need online worms to function their magic.

It depends on what you're fishing for and where you're fishing. Red worms are smaller sized and, therefore, excellent for trout and panfish, while Nightcrawlers are bigger and much better for larger varieties like bass and catfish.
